Web15 mrt. 2024 · High-carbon steel has a higher amount of carbon content (over 0.5%) than low-carbon steel (less than 0.2%). This higher amount of carbon gives high-carbon steel its hardness, strength, and durability. It also makes it much harder to shape or form than low-carbon steel. Most steels have a carbon content of below 0.35 wt% carbon. Low-carbon steel designed for welding applications, for example, has a carbon content of below 0.25 wt%, and often, the carbon content is below 0.15 wt%.
